What’s the difference between sweatpants and joggers?

There’s often confusion between these two categories, even among professionals. Let’s clear it up.

Joggers are generally slimmer, more tapered at the ankle, and have a sleeker, athletic aesthetic. Sweatpants tend to be roomier and are associated with relaxed, lounge-focused wear.

Comparison of athletic joggers and lounge joggers in tan tones Athletic vs. Lounge

Fit and Silhouette Comparison

The fit can completely change how the garment feels and performs.

  • Sweatpants: Wide fit, straight cut, elastic waistband.
  • Joggers: Tapered legs, cuffed ankles, often mid-rise or slim-fit.

Historical Usage and Modern Evolution

Sweatpants date back to the 1920s as athletic warmups. Joggers rose in popularity in the 2010s, blending sportswear and fashion. Now, both are used far beyond the gym.

Target Consumer Demographics

  • Sweatpants: Preferred by older demographics and loungewear buyers.
  • Joggers: Popular among Gen Z and Millennials looking for streetwear vibes.

Fabric matters: what really impacts comfort?

Fabric is everything. The wrong blend can kill even the best silhouette.

Cotton fleece offers warmth and softness, French Terry delivers light breathability, and poly blends increase stretch and durability. The fabric must match the product’s end use.

Common Materials Used (Cotton Fleece1, French Terry2, Poly Blends3)

Fabric Type Feel Common Use
Cotton Fleece Soft & warm Loungewear
French Terry Lightweight & airy Daily casual wear
Poly/Spandex Blend Stretchy & durable Training wear

Breathability, Weight, and Texture Analysis

  • French Terry is more breathable than fleece.
  • Poly blends are best for heat regulation and sweat-wicking.
  • Texture (brushed vs. unbrushed) also changes perceived comfort.

Seasonal Fabric Preferences in US vs. Europe

  • US Buyers: Prefer fleece in winter, French Terry in spring.
  • Europe: Lightweight blends dominate due to layering habits.

How does end-use affect the comfort debate?

Comfort isn’t universal—it depends on activity and context.

For lounging, sweatpants win. For training or urban wear, joggers perform better due to fit and function.

Performance Features vs. Comfort Priorities

  • Joggers often include zippers, mesh panels, and moisture-wicking.
  • Sweatpants keep it simple: plush linings, wider fits, no extras.

Gender-Specific Design Preferences

  • Women tend to prefer joggers with high-waist fits and cropped lengths.
  • Men gravitate toward thicker sweats with drawstring waists and deep pockets.

Age Group and Lifestyle Fit

  • Gen Z wants versatility: gym to street.
  • Older consumers prioritize softness and warmth.

What do consumers say? Comfort feedback and return data

Let’s turn to the numbers and voices of actual customers.

Brands report fewer returns on joggers due to better fit, while sweatpants are more likely to be returned for being too baggy or heavy.

Brand Case Studies (e.g., H&M, Zara, Lululemon)

  • Lululemon joggers are favored for four-way stretch and moisture control.
  • Zara offers both, but joggers consistently outsell sweats among 20–35 age group.

Comfort Ratings in Customer Reviews

Customers rate joggers higher on style-meets-comfort scales. Sweatpants still lead in the loungewear niche.

Common Reasons for Returns

  • Sweatpants: "Too hot" or "fit too loose"
  • Joggers: "Too tight at ankle", but fewer fabric complaints
